Store launches accident help
A CAMPAIGN to raise awareness about major causes of accidents in the home was to be launched at Edinburgh Ikea today.
A year-long programme of activities, co-ordinated by Home Safety Scotland, will cover topics including falls, electrical equipment safety, burns and scalds, garden safety and carbon monoxide.
RoSPA Scotland's home safety development officer, Nicola Butters, said: "Tremendous progress has been made in reducing the number of lives affected by home accidents, but figures show more still needs to be done to reduce suffering caused by them."
